Kandal Real Estate Market Trends You Should Know

The Kandal real estate market has been a topic of interest for homebuyers, investors, and real estate agents alike. With its strategic location near Phnom Penh, Kandal offers a mix of urban conveniences and suburban charm. Understanding the latest trends in this market can help potential buyers and investors make informed decisions.

1. Rising Property Prices
In recent years, Kandal has seen a significant increase in property prices. The influx of people moving from Phnom Penh to Kandal for more affordable housing options has driven demand. As a result, both residential and commercial properties have become valuable investments. Reports indicate that the average property price in Kandal has risen by approximately 10-15% year over year.

2. Increased Demand for Residential Properties
The demand for residential homes in Kandal has been on the rise, particularly for single-family homes and townhouses. Families are drawn to Kandal for its more spacious living options and better quality of life. Developers have responded by constructing a variety of new residential projects, catering to both low and middle-income buyers.

4. The Influence of Foreign Investment
Foreign investment is playing a crucial role in shaping the Kandal real estate landscape. Investors from various countries are increasingly interested in the area, given its growth potential. This influx of capital has led to improved infrastructure and enhanced property values, making Kandal a prime location for real estate investment.

5. Infrastructure Development
Kandal’s infrastructure has been steadily improving, with new roads, schools, and healthcare facilities being developed. The government has allocated funds to enhance public services and transportation, making the area more accessible. Enhanced infrastructure not only elevates living standards but also boosts the property market by attracting more buyers.

6. Emerging Commercial Spaces
As Kandal continues to expand, there is a growing demand for commercial real estate. Investors are recognizing the value of creating retail spaces, offices, and mixed-use developments. This shift reflects the area's growing population, which is driving the need for more businesses and services to cater to residents.
